SCHEDULE 12E+W+SProtective provisions

PART 2E+W+SProtection for Network Rail Infrastructure limited

14.—(1) The undertaker must not exercise the powers conferred by article 13 (authority to survey and investigate the land) or the powers conferred by section 11(3) of the 1965 Act (powers of entry) in respect of any railway property unless the exercise of such powers is with the consent of Network Rail.E+W+S

(2) The undertaker must not in the exercise of the powers conferred by this Order prevent pedestrian or vehicular access to any railway property, unless preventing such access is with the consent of Network Rail.

(3) The undertaker must not exercise the powers conferred by sections 271 or 272 of the 1990 Act (extinguishment of rights of statutory undertakers and electronic code communications operators — preliminary notices), or article 25 (statutory undertakers), in relation to any right of access of Network Rail to railway property, but such right of access may be diverted with the consent of Network Rail.

(4) The undertaker must not under the powers of this Order acquire or use or acquire new rights over any railway property except with the consent of Network Rail.

(5) Where Network Rail is asked to give its consent or agreement pursuant to this paragraph, such consent or agreement must not be unreasonably withheld but may be given subject to reasonable conditions.
